I've been working on an exercise to generate the English "Twelve
days of Christmas song". So far, I've come up with the following:
for(<DATA>){s/%/ing/;$_=($i++?$i-1+print"
":a)." $_";print"On the $i",(st,nd,rd)[$i-1]||th," day of Christmas,
my true love gave to me:
",$t=$_.$t}__DATA__
partridge in a pear tree.
turtle doves and
French hens,
call% birds,
golden rings,
geese a-lay%,
swans a-swimm%,
maids a-milk%,
ladies danc%,
lords a-leap%,
pipers pip%,
drummers drumm%,

My script is 343 bytes, which is better than zip and tar+gzip but worse than gzip:
Does anybody have a shorter solution? For simplicity's sake, I've limited the challenge to digits rather
than written numbers.
